[Remote] Sr. Scala Developer

Remote Full-time
Note: The job is a remote job and is open to candidates in USA. Dice is the leading career destination for tech experts, and they are seeking two Senior Scala Developers to join their software engineering team. The role involves building and enhancing high-performance, client-facing REST APIs for consumer-facing video services, requiring independent work on complex projects and effective collaboration in a fast-paced environment. Responsibilities • Design, develop, and implement new microservices and enhance existing ones at scale. • Translate business requirements into detailed design, solutions, and functional architecture. • Write and maintain high-quality, testable, and performant code. • Collaborate with team members and internal stakeholders to solve complex technical problems. Skills • Strong development experience with Scala. • Proven experience in designing and building REST APIs. • Experience with NoSQL databases. • Solid understanding of testing and debugging practices. • Experience with Scala's Futures for asynchronous functionality. • Comfortable working closely with a team in a fast-paced environment. • Experience with a Scala web framework like Scalatra. • Knowledge of distributed systems and message queues. • Familiarity with containerization tools like Docker and Kubernetes. • Experience with caching architectures. • Knowledge of logging and monitoring tools. • Understanding of functional programming and reactive patterns. • Experience with CI/CD automation. • Experience with cloud platforms. • Knowledge of API documentation (e.g., Swagger/OpenAPI). Company Overview • Welcome to Jobs via Dice, the go-to destination for discovering the tech jobs you want. It was founded in undefined, and is headquartered in , with a workforce of 0-1 employees. Its website is Apply tot his job
Apply Now →

Similar Jobs

Experienced Registered Behavior Technician for In-Home ABA Therapy - Atlanta, GA

Remote

Immediate Hiring: Experienced Registered Behavioral Technician (RBT) for Clinic-Based ABA Therapy Services

Remote

Experienced Registered Behavioral Technician (RBT) - ABA Therapy for Children with Autism Spectrum Disorder

Remote

Experienced Registered Nurse - Telehealth: Providing Remote Care Coordination and Patient Support

Remote

Experienced Substitute Teacher for Riverside County Schools - Join Scoot Education's Innovative Team

Remote

Experienced Substitute Teacher for San Bernardino County - Flexible Schedules & Competitive Pay

Remote

Experienced School Year Instructional Coach for High-Dosage Tutoring Programs in Edgewater Park, NJ

Remote

Experienced School Year Tutor for K-8 Students in Math and Literacy - Mickleton, NJ

Remote

Experienced Secondary Social Studies Teacher for Kansas - Flexible Hybrid Remote Arrangement

Remote

USPS Office Helper

Remote

Copywriter - Social Media Content Writer

Remote

HIM Coder-Level I

Remote

Courier/Feeder Agt/Non-DOT

Remote

Title Abstractor (Search Specialist)

Remote

Payroll/HR Generalist, U.S. (Remote)

Remote

Remote Certified Pharmacy Technician (Start of Care)

Remote

Experienced Remote Data Entry Specialist – Accurate and Efficient Data Management Professional for arenaflex

Remote

**Experienced Customer Service Associate - Temporary Role at blithequark**

Remote

Senior SIU Desk Investigator (Remote, Contract)

Remote

Senior Software Engineer, Back-end (LatAm)

Remote
← Back